IP Country City ISP
146.70.194.252 United Kingdom Yorkshire Electricity
146.70.194.7 United Kingdom Yorkshire Electricity
146.70.196.156 United Kingdom Yorkshire Electricity
193.32.127.220 United Kingdom 31173 Services AB
51.159.35.56 United Kingdom ONLINE SAS
51.77.64.47 United Kingdom OVH SAS
89.249.74.213 United Kingdom Eastbourne So Internet